
Excel表格变大的原因主要包括:数据量多、使用了大量的公式和函数、包含了大量的图表和图片、隐藏数据和格式化设置。 在这些因素中,最常见的原因是数据量多和大量使用公式。数据量多直接增加了文件的大小,而公式和函数的复杂性则会增加文件的处理时间和存储需求。
一、数据量多
1.1 数据量带来的影响
Excel表格文件变大最直接的原因是其中包含了大量的数据。每一个单元格中的数据都会占用一定的存储空间,当数据量达到一定规模时,文件的大小自然会显著增加。特别是当你在一个表格中存储了数十万甚至上百万条记录时,文件的大小会急剧增长。
1.2 如何优化数据量
为了解决数据量过大的问题,可以采取以下几种方法:
- 使用外部数据库: 如果你的数据量特别大,可以考虑将数据存储在外部数据库中,如SQL Server、MySQL等,然后通过Excel的外部数据连接功能来访问这些数据。
- 分割数据: 如果可能的话,将数据分成多个较小的表格文件,这样可以减小每个文件的大小,方便管理和处理。
- 删除无用数据: 定期检查表格,删除那些不再需要的数据和行列。
二、使用了大量的公式和函数
2.1 公式和函数的影响
Excel表格中的公式和函数会显著增加文件的复杂性和大小。特别是那些涉及到跨表格引用、大量嵌套的公式和复杂的数组公式,这些都会占用大量的存储空间和计算资源。
2.2 如何优化公式和函数
为了减少公式和函数对文件大小的影响,可以采取以下几种方法:
- 使用更高效的公式: 尽量使用简单、高效的公式来代替复杂的嵌套公式。例如,可以使用SUMIFS、COUNTIFS等函数来代替SUMPRODUCT等复杂公式。
- 减少跨表引用: 尽量减少公式中跨表引用的次数,因为这些引用会增加文件的复杂性和计算时间。
- 使用宏和VBA: 对于一些复杂的计算,可以考虑使用Excel的宏和VBA功能,将这些计算移到代码中进行,这样可以减少公式的使用。
三、包含了大量的图表和图片
3.1 图表和图片的影响
在Excel表格中插入大量的图表和图片也会显著增加文件的大小。每一张图片和图表都会占用一定的存储空间,特别是高分辨率的图片和复杂的图表。
3.2 如何优化图表和图片
为了减少图表和图片对文件大小的影响,可以采取以下几种方法:
- 压缩图片: 使用Excel内置的图片压缩功能,将图片的分辨率降低到合适的水平,这样可以显著减少文件的大小。
- 减少图表数量: 只保留那些必要的图表,对于一些不常用的图表,可以考虑将其移到其他文件中。
- 使用链接: 对于一些大型的图片,可以考虑使用链接的方式,这样图片不会嵌入到Excel文件中,而是链接到外部文件。
四、隐藏数据和格式化设置
4.1 隐藏数据和格式化的影响
隐藏的数据和复杂的格式化设置(如条件格式、单元格样式等)也会增加Excel文件的大小。这些隐藏的数据虽然不可见,但仍然占用存储空间和计算资源。
4.2 如何优化隐藏数据和格式化
为了减少隐藏数据和格式化对文件大小的影响,可以采取以下几种方法:
- 清理隐藏数据: 定期检查和清理那些不再需要的隐藏数据和行列。
- 简化格式化设置: 尽量使用简单的格式化设置,避免过度使用条件格式和复杂的单元格样式。
- 使用标准样式: 尽量使用Excel内置的标准样式,而不是自定义样式,这样可以减少文件的复杂性。
五、其他因素
5.1 增量保存
Excel文件在每次保存时,会保存一些增量变化的信息,这些信息会随着时间的推移而累积,导致文件大小逐渐增加。
5.2 版本兼容性
不同版本的Excel在文件格式和存储机制上可能存在差异,特别是从较旧版本升级到较新版本时,文件大小可能会有所变化。
5.3 插件和扩展
一些Excel插件和扩展会在文件中嵌入额外的信息和数据,这些也会导致文件大小的增加。
5.4 数据连接
如果Excel文件中包含了外部数据连接(如SQL数据库、Web服务等),这些连接和查询信息也会占用一定的存储空间。
六、如何全面优化Excel文件
6.1 删除冗余数据
定期检查和删除那些不再需要的冗余数据和行列,这样可以显著减少文件的大小。
6.2 使用高效的公式和函数
尽量使用简单、高效的公式和函数来代替复杂的嵌套公式,这样可以减少文件的复杂性和大小。
6.3 压缩图片和图表
使用Excel内置的图片压缩功能,将图片的分辨率降低到合适的水平;同时,只保留那些必要的图表,减少文件的大小。
6.4 清理隐藏数据和格式化
定期检查和清理那些不再需要的隐藏数据和行列,同时简化格式化设置,避免过度使用条件格式和复杂的单元格样式。
6.5 使用外部数据库
对于特别大的数据集,可以考虑将数据存储在外部数据库中,然后通过Excel的外部数据连接功能来访问这些数据。
6.6 定期优化和维护
定期对Excel文件进行优化和维护,检查文件大小和复杂性,确保文件始终保持在一个合理的范围内。
通过以上方法,可以有效地解决Excel表格文件过大的问题,提高文件的处理效率和存储空间利用率。希望这篇文章能够为你提供一些实用的建议和方法,帮助你更好地管理和优化Excel表格文件。
相关问答FAQs:
1. 为什么我的Excel表格文件大小超出了预期?
- Excel表格文件大小可能会超出预期的原因有很多,例如包含大量数据、复杂的公式、嵌入的图表或图像等。请检查表格中是否存在大量数据或复杂的计算,这可能会导致文件大小增大。
2. 如何减小Excel表格文件的大小?
- 有几种方法可以减小Excel表格文件的大小。首先,你可以删除或清理掉不需要的数据、行和列,只保留必要的内容。其次,可以尝试使用压缩工具将文件进行压缩,以减小文件大小。此外,还可以将图表和图像转换为更低分辨率或更小的文件格式,以减小文件大小。
3. 如何优化Excel表格以减小文件大小?
- 优化Excel表格可以帮助减小文件大小。首先,你可以尝试使用Excel的“合并单元格”功能来减少表格的单元格数量。其次,可以使用Excel的“条件格式”功能来简化格式设置,减少文件大小。另外,避免使用复杂的公式或函数,这可能会导致文件大小增加。最后,使用适当的文件格式,如XLSX而不是XLS等,可以减小文件大小。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4317386